Description

The Women's Income Growth and Self-reliance (WINGS) programme is a new partnership between DFID and the Government of Punjab to design, pilot, adapt, scale-up and sustain
systems to enable the poorest women and their families to develop productive livelihoods, generate income and exit extreme poverty for good. The programme will focus on "graduation" of beneficiaries who currently benefit or are eligible to benefit from cash stipends in Punjab delivered either through BISP or PSPA.
